Efficiently feed and discharge difficult materials
The BU Twin Shaft Screw Feeder by WAMGROUP is designed to provide efficient discharging and feeding from bins or hoppers, particularly for non-homogeneous and bridging materials. The BU features tapered inlet sections that facilitate mass flow and prevent material segregation. Constructed from powder-coated carbon steel, the feeder’s robust design includes maintenance-free flanged cast iron end bearing assemblies and self-lubricating slide bushes. It is ATEX, Zone 22 certified, making it suitable for use in potentially explosive environments. Typical applications include the handling of wood chippings, bran, flour, sawdust, and soy in industries such as flour milling and feed production. The BU’s modular design allows for easy access and customization to meet specific operational needs, while fixed or variable speed gear motors ensure reliable and constant feed rates.
